The history of Coffee To Go

Coffee is one of the most popular drinks in the world, but its history is quite interesting. Coffee was first discovered by an Ethiopian goat herder who noticed that his goats were more energetic after eating the beans of a certain bush. The beans were then roasted and brewed, and soon the word about the energizing effects of this drink began to spread. By the 15th century, coffee had become a popular beverage in the Middle East, and by the 16th century, it had spread to Europe and the New World. From there, it spread to many other countries, including the United States. The popularity of coffee in the USA has only increased over time. It is now a staple of many people’s daily routines and is available from a variety of establishments, from cafes to convenience stores. The benefits of Coffee To Go

Coffee is one of the most widely consumed beverages in the world, and with good reason. It has many health benefits that can make it an important part of your daily routine. From boosting your energy levels to improving your mood, there are plenty of advantages to drinking coffee. One of the most popular benefits of coffee is its ability to boost energy levels. Coffee contains caffeine, a natural stimulant that can give you an extra boost of energy when you need it most. Caffeine helps improve alertness and can even increase physical performance in some cases. Another benefit of drinking coffee is its ability to improve focus and concentration. Coffee can help keep you mentally sharp and alert, allowing you to concentrate better on the tasks at hand. This can be especially beneficial for those who suffer from attention deficit disorder (ADD) or other mental health issues.
